Searched refs:IndexedListSet (Results 1 – 12 of 12) sorted by relevance
/frameworks/base/services/permission/java/com/android/server/permission/access/immutable/ |
D | IndexedListSetExtensions.kt | 19 inline fun <T> IndexedListSet<T>.allIndexed(predicate: (Int, T) -> Boolean): Boolean { in <lambda>() 28 inline fun <T> IndexedListSet<T>.anyIndexed(predicate: (Int, T) -> Boolean): Boolean { in anyIndexed() 37 inline fun <T> IndexedListSet<T>.forEachIndexed(action: (Int, T) -> Unit) { in forEachIndexed() 43 inline fun <T> IndexedListSet<T>.forEachReversedIndexed(action: (Int, T) -> Unit) { in forEachReversedIndexed() 49 inline val <T> IndexedListSet<T>.lastIndex: Int 52 operator fun <T> IndexedListSet<T>.minus(element: T): MutableIndexedListSet<T> = in minus() 55 inline fun <T> IndexedListSet<T>.noneIndexed(predicate: (Int, T) -> Boolean): Boolean { in noneIndexed() 64 operator fun <T> IndexedListSet<T>.plus(element: T): MutableIndexedListSet<T> = in plus() 68 inline fun <T> IndexedListSet<T>.reduceIndexed( in reduceIndexed()
|
D | IndexedListSet.kt | 20 sealed class IndexedListSet<T>(internal val list: ArrayList<T>) : class 39 class MutableIndexedListSet<T>(list: ArrayList<T> = ArrayList()) : IndexedListSet<T>(list) { in isEmpty() 40 constructor(indexedListSet: IndexedListSet<T>) : this(ArrayList(indexedListSet.list)) in isEmpty()
|
/frameworks/base/services/permission/java/com/android/server/permission/access/ |
D | AccessState.kt | 90 typealias AppIdPackageNames = IntReferenceMap<IndexedListSet<String>, MutableIndexedListSet<String>> 93 MutableIntReferenceMap<IndexedListSet<String>, MutableIndexedListSet<String>> 106 privilegedPermissionAllowlistPackages: IndexedListSet<String>, 108 implicitToSourcePermissions: IndexedMap<String, IndexedListSet<String>>, 132 var privilegedPermissionAllowlistPackages: IndexedListSet<String> = 139 var implicitToSourcePermissions: IndexedMap<String, IndexedListSet<String>> = 158 privilegedPermissionAllowlistPackages: IndexedListSet<String>, in toMutable() 160 implicitToSourcePermissions: IndexedMap<String, IndexedListSet<String>>, in toMutable() 238 privilegedPermissionAllowlistPackages: IndexedListSet<String> in toMutable() 250 implicitToSourcePermissions: IndexedMap<String, IndexedListSet<String>> in toMutable()
|
D | AccessCheckingService.kt | 116 private val SystemConfig.privilegedPermissionAllowlistPackages: IndexedListSet<String> in <lambda>() 132 private val SystemConfig.implicitToSourcePermissions: IndexedMap<String, IndexedListSet<String>> in <lambda>() 143 } as IndexedMap<String, IndexedListSet<String>> in <lambda>()
|
D | AccessPolicy.kt | 72 privilegedPermissionAllowlistPackages: IndexedListSet<String>, in <lambda>() 74 implicitToSourcePermissions: IndexedMap<String, IndexedListSet<String>> in <lambda>()
|
/frameworks/base/services/permission/java/com/android/server/permission/access/appop/ |
D | PackageAppOpPolicy.kt | 35 private var onAppOpModeChangedListeners: IndexedListSet<OnAppOpModeChangedListener> = in <lambda>()
|
D | AppIdAppOpPolicy.kt | 35 private var onAppOpModeChangedListeners: IndexedListSet<OnAppOpModeChangedListener> = in <lambda>()
|
/frameworks/base/services/tests/PermissionServiceMockingTests/src/com/android/server/permission/test/ |
D | AppIdPermissionPolicyPermissionStatesTest.kt | 23 import com.android.server.permission.access.immutable.IndexedListSet 440 MutableIndexedMap<String, IndexedListSet<String>>().apply { in testEvaluatePermissionState_implicitSourceFromNonRuntime_getsImplicitGranted() 750 MutableIndexedMap<String, IndexedListSet<String>>().apply { in testInheritImplicitPermissionStates()
|
/frameworks/base/services/permission/java/com/android/server/permission/access/permission/ |
D | DevicePermissionPolicy.kt | 39 private var listeners: IndexedListSet<OnDevicePermissionFlagsChangedListener> = in <lambda>()
|
D | AppIdPermissionPolicy.kt | 60 IndexedListSet<OnPermissionFlagsChangedListener> = in <lambda>()
|
/frameworks/base/services/ |
D | art-wear-profile | 690 Lcom/android/server/permission/access/immutable/IndexedListSet; 17047 …s(Lcom/android/server/SystemConfig;)Lcom/android/server/permission/access/immutable/IndexedListSet; 17079 …tMap;ZLjava/util/Map;Lcom/android/server/permission/access/immutable/IndexedListSet;Lcom/android/s… 17103 …tMap;ZLjava/util/Map;Lcom/android/server/permission/access/immutable/IndexedListSet;Lcom/android/s… 17104 …tMap;ZLjava/util/Map;Lcom/android/server/permission/access/immutable/IndexedListSet;Lcom/android/s… 17113 …vilegedPermissionAllowlistPackages()Lcom/android/server/permission/access/immutable/IndexedListSet; 17125 …ilegedPermissionAllowlistPackages(Lcom/android/server/permission/access/immutable/IndexedListSet;)V 17142 …tMap;ZLjava/util/Map;Lcom/android/server/permission/access/immutable/IndexedListSet;Lcom/android/s… 17152 …PermissionAllowlistPackagesPublic(Lcom/android/server/permission/access/immutable/IndexedListSet;)V 17306 HSPLcom/android/server/permission/access/immutable/IndexedListSet;-><init>(Ljava/util/ArrayList;)V [all …]
|
D | art-profile | 2157 HSPLcom/android/server/permission/access/immutable/IndexedListSet;->elementAt(I)Ljava/lang/Object;+… 2158 HSPLcom/android/server/permission/access/immutable/IndexedListSet;->getSize()I+]Ljava/util/ArrayLis…
|